That's where you come in. We're looking for someone with real-world experience in cloud engineering and the confidence to work independently on core infrastructure tasks. You don't need to be a domain expert, but you should be hungry to learn, comfortable navigating unfamiliar systems, and confident in your ability to figure things out. At Reingold, Google Cloud engineering isn't just a support function; it's a key part of how we deliver innovative, AI-powered solutions for our clients. You'll use a code-first approach to build and manage Google Cloud infrastructure for advanced conversational AI applications, working with cross-functional teams to build systems that are secure, scalable, and repeatable. You'll also implement robust CI/CD pipelines for deploying applications, and leverage Google Cloud's suite to help teams own their services in production, spot issues early, and fix them fast.

This is a hybrid role, requiring at least two days per week on site at Reingold's headquarters in Alexandria, VA.


Here's the work you'll do:

Essential Functions:

  • Design, build, and maintain conversational AI solutions using Google Cloud services like Vertex AI Search and Dialogflow CX.
  • Collaborate with development teams to integrate and manage a suite of Google Cloud APIs, including Discovery Engine, Cloud Storage, and BigQuery, ensuring secure and efficient data flow.
  • Develop and manage API proxies and security policies to facilitate robust integrations between backend services and client-facing applications.
  • Monitor the health and performance of GCP services, including App Engine and Compute Engine instances, using Cloud Monitoring and Logging to ensure high availability and reliability.
  • Implement and manage Identity and Access Management (IAM) policies and service accounts within GCP to maintain a secure and compliant cloud environment.
  • Automate cloud infrastructure tasks and workflows using Python scripting to improve operational efficiency and consistency.
  • Identify and remediate security vulnerabilities using common scanning and reporting tools, in coordination with security guidelines.
  • Maintain up-to-date documentation and process flows that align with internal standards and operational requirements.Perform ad-hoc tasks based on evolving team priorities and your individual skills or areas of interest.

This role is a good fit for someone with these qualifications, experience and skills:

Required Qualifications:

  • Active Public Trust clearance or ability to obtain one
  • Bachelor's degree, preferably in computer science, engineering, web development, or related field.
  • Formal training in computer science, information technology, DevOps, or a related field either through a college degree program or an immersive professional training program.
  • Hands-on experience deploying and managing applications and services on Google Cloud Platform.
  • Practical experience building or maintaining solutions that leverage Google Cloud's AI and data services.
  • Proficiency in scripting languages such as Python or Bash for automating cloud tasks and API integrations.
  • Familiarity with version control systems like Git and the ability to collaborate effectively in a team-based development environment.
  • Understanding of cloud administration fundamentals, including networking, IAM, and security best practices within a GCP environment.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Direct experience building and tuning chatbots or virtual agents using Dialogflow CX and integrating them with data sources via Vertex AI Search and Discovery Engine.
  • Familiarity with managing APIs through an API gateway, preferably Google Apigee, including setting up proxies and authentication policies.
  • Experience working with Google Cloud data services such as BigQuery for analytics, Cloud Storage for object storage, and Cloud Datastore for NoSQL databases.
  • Knowledge of securing sensitive data within GCP using tools like Cloud Data Loss Prevention (DLP) API.
  • Prior experience in a development-focused role, especially if you've integrated various Google Cloud APIs to build and ship real web applications.
  • Comfort working across cloud-native services, infrastructure components, and security controls, with a strong sense of when to leverage managed services versus building custom solutions.
  • Excellent problem-solving instincts and a curiosity-driven mindset, especially around performance, reliability, and automation.
  • Strong communication skills and the ability to collaborate effectively with developers, engineers, project managers, leadership, and clients.
